Produktbeschreibung:

Der DeWalt DCD 800 ist ein leistungsstarker 2-Gang Akku Bohrschrauber der neuesten Generation. Im Vergleich zum Vorgängermodell bietet er eine höhere Abgabeleistung, ein stärkeres Drehmoment sowie eine höhere Bohrleistung bei gleichzeitig kompakteren Abmessungen. Dank der innovativen, bürstenlosen Motor-Technologie bietet der DCD 800 eine lange Laufzeit pro Akku-Ladung sowie eine höhere Lebensdauer. Das 2-Gang-Vollmetallgetriebe sorgt für eine perfekte Kraftübertragung und das 15-stufige Drehmomentmodul gewährleistet präzise Schraubarbeiten in allen Einstellungen. Die Schalterelektronik des DCD 800 lässt sich leicht dosieren, was exaktes Anbohren und präzises Schrauben ermöglicht. Die Sicherheitselektronik sorgt für einen problemlosen Langzeiteinsatz, indem sie die Akku-Temperatur, Stromentnahme und Entladeschutz permanent überprüft. Das extrem robuste 13 mm Schnellspann-Bohrfutter aus Vollmetall mit zentrisch spannenden Backen sorgt für eine problemlose Handhabung. Mit einer Gesamtlänge von nur 16,4 cm ist der Akku Bohrschrauber äußerst kompakt und verfügt über ein ergonomisch gummiertes Gehäuse für ein Maximum an Sicherheit und Arbeitskomfort. Die innovative dreistufige und im Leuchtwinkel stufenlos verstellbare LED-Leuchte mit hoher Leuchtkraft sorgt für problemloses Arbeiten bei allen Lichtverhältnissen. Praktische Ausstattungsmerkmale wie ein robuster Metall-Gürtelhaken und ein magnetischer Bithalter machen den DCD 800 zu einem vielseitigen Werkzeug. Der DCD 800 ist kompatibel mit allen 18 Volt Li-Ion XR-Akkus.

Technische Daten:

Hersteller: DeWalt
Herstellerbezeichnung: DCD 800
Leerlaufdrehzah: 650 / 2000 min-1
max. Drehmoment (h/w): 90 / 27 Nm
max. Bohrleistung in Holz / Metal: 55 / 13 mm
Bohrfutterspannweite: 1,5 - 13 mm
Gewicht : 1,28 kg
Schalldruckpegel (LPA): 74 db(A)
Schallleistungspegel (LWA): 85 db(A)
K-Wert (Schalldruck): 5 db(A)
Vibrationen (bei Bohren in Metall): < 2,5 m/s2
K-Wert (Vibrationen): 1,5 m/s2
